Title: **Innovator Dongbo Cui: Pioneering Audience Measurement Techniques**
Introduction
Dongbo Cui is a notable inventor based in New York, NY, whose contributions to the field of audience measurement have resulted in an impressive portfolio of 13 patents. His innovative work addresses the complexities of estimating audience sizes and impression counts across various demographics, leading to enhancements in media analytics.
Latest Patents
Cui's latest patents showcase his expertise in developing methods and apparatus focused on audience measurement. One such patent is titled "Methods and apparatus to estimate census level impression counts and unique audience sizes across demographics." This invention includes an audience size calculator circuitry and an impression count calculator circuitry. The system is designed to verify audience parameter values, ensuring accuracy in audience size estimations.
Additionally, he holds a patent for "Methods and apparatus to estimate audience sizes and durations of media accesses." This innovation utilizes advanced computational techniques with memory and processor circuitry to assess audience sizes and durations correlated with media events. These contributions are instrumental in providing accurate insights into media consumption patterns.
Career Highlights
Dongbo Cui serves as an inventor at The Nielsen Company LLC, where he contributes significantly to advancements in audience measurement technologies. His work in analytics is crucial for understanding viewer behavior and delivering precise audience statistics to clients spanning various media platforms.
Collaborations
Cui has collaborated with esteemed colleagues, including Michael R. Sheppard and Diane Morovati Lopez, further enriching his work through shared expertise and innovative ideas. These partnerships reflect a synergistic approach to solving complex challenges in audience measurement.
